<noscript date-time="sry38hm"></noscript><address id="xd518z9"></address><bdo lang="fa02zu0"></bdo><abbr draggable="f4dgz00"></abbr><bdo draggable="sb1rbrq"></bdo>

TPWallet无法打开DApp的深度剖析:安全、智能与全球化视角

问题概述

近期有用户反映 TPWallet 无法打开某些 DApp,这表面看似兼容性或网络问题,实际上牵涉钱包与 DApp 交互、浏览器环境、RPC 层、以及安全策略等多维因素。本篇从技术根源、安全对策、未来智能化趋势、专家视角、全球化影响及高效数据存储方案六个方面做深入讨论。

可能的根因

- 注入提供者检测失败:许多 DApp 依赖 EIP-1193 注入 provider 或 WalletConnect,如果 TPWallet 的注入方式或命名空间与预期不符,DApp 可能无法识别。

- RPC 与链切换问题:不一致的 chainId、节点不可用、CORS 限制或自定义 RPC 被屏蔽都会导致加载失败。

- 权限/交互流程阻断:若扩展/移动钱包未正确响应 dApp 的请求(如 eth_requestAccounts、signTypedData),DApp 会卡住。

- 防篡改或旁路逻辑:部分 DApp 为防旁路攻击加入严格的 origin 栈、时间戳和非对称验证,若钱包没有提供相应的证明机制,会被拒绝连接。

防旁路攻击策略(给开发者与钱包厂商的建议)

- 强化来源与链验证:DApp 应校验 origin、referer、chainId 与签名中的 domain 字段(如 EIP-712 中的域分离),避免仅依赖 URL。钱包应在签名流程中返回域名/chain id 的不可伪造证明。

- 使用设备/环境证明:结合硬件根(TPM、Secure Enclave、TEE)进行 attestation,防止被注入或模拟环境旁路。

- 非交互性校验与二次确认:对于高风险操作,引入二次签名、多签或阈值签名(MPC)以降低单点旁路风险。

钓鱼攻击与防御

- 钓鱼手法更隐蔽:伪造 DApp 域名、诱导切换 RPC、仿冒签名请求、仿真交易预览界面。

- 多层防御:钱包应提供交易预览、EIP-712 可读化、风险评分、黑名单/信誉系统及机器学习驱动的可疑行为检测。用户端要核对域名、审慎授权、使用硬件钱包或多重验证。

智能化未来世界

- AI 驱动的智能钱包:通过本地或受信任代理的模型自动分类请求风险、自动填充低风险许可、拒绝异常行为。结合联邦学习,钱包厂商可在保护隐私的同时提升风控能力。

- 自动化合约理解与模拟:钱包在签名前对交易调用进行沙箱执行、模拟状态变更并以可视化方式告知用户潜在资产流向。

专家观点剖析(要点汇总)

- 安全工程师:依赖硬件根与 attestation 是防止旁路的关键,但实现成本与兼容性需平衡。

- 区块链研发:标准化签名域(EIP-712)与链间互操作协议是减轻兼容性问题的长期出路。

- 法律/合规顾问:全球化环境下,跨境数据与身份验证会面临监管碎片化,需在隐私保护与合规间寻求技术与法律结合方案。

全球化数字技术影响

- 标准化与互操作:WalletConnect、W3C Wallet API 等标准推动跨设备、跨链的统一接入,降低 DApp 与钱包之间适配成本。

- 监管差异:不同司法区对 KYC/AML、数据本地化有不同要求,钱包与 DApp 在设计时应考虑可配置的合规模块与隐私保护层(如零知识证明来做合规证明而不泄露原始数据)。

高效数据存储策略

- 链上/链下折衷:把关键状态与证明放链上(Merkle roots、事件日志),把大量媒体或历史数据放到 IPFS/Arweave 或专用 Layer2。

- 数据可用性与验证:使用 Merkle 树、轻客户端证明、zk-SNARK/zk-STARK 等压缩证明机制来在不暴露全部数据的前提下验证状态。

- 存储成本与访问性能:Layer2 聚合与分层存储可降低费用并提升读写效率,同时保证通过可验证证明追溯链上根值。

实用建议(给用户与开发者)

- 用户:遇到 DApp 打不开,先检查钱包版本、切换 RPC、重启钱包并查看是否有权限提示;对可疑网站使用硬件钱包或拒绝授权。

- 开发者:实现 EIP-1193 标准、兼容 WalletConnect、在签名请求中包含明确域信息并做好降级处理;对高风险操作引入多签/阈签或二次确认。

结论

TPWallet 无法打开 DApp 并非孤立问题,它是安全模型、兼容性实现、全球监管和未来智能化需求交织的产物。通过标准化接口、硬件/证明级别的 attestation、AI 驱动的风险判断和高效的链上链下存储策略,生态能够在兼容性与安全之间取得更好的平衡。

作者:程梓发布时间:2025-11-29 08:05:12

评论

Luna

很全面的分析,特别赞同用 EIP-712 加强域绑定的建议。

老陈

建议把硬件钱包和多签方案写得更具体些,落地操作很重要。

CryptoFan88

智能钱包自动化风险评分听起来很实用,期待更多实现细节。

未来观察者

全球化合规部分切中要害,监管差异确实是大问题。

相关阅读